Web7 jun. 2024 · 📸 The French word for a camera to take pictures is “un appareil photo”. We often only use the word “appareil”, but we never use the word ‘camera’ for a camera to take pictures. 🎥 The French word for a movie camera is “une caméra”. More French movie vocabulary. 📹 The French word for a video camera, a camcorder, is also “une caméra”. WebThe process of pointing a camera at an object and pressing the shutter button is called “taking a picture” or “taking a photo (graph)”, for example: correct I took a photo of the recent solar eclipse. unnatural I made a photo of the recent solar eclipse.
